WebMar 24, 2015 · Show 1. 1. Recall that if N(a + ib) = a2 + b2 and d, x ∈ Z[i], then d ∣ x implies N(d) ∣ N(x). Now, an easy computation shows that N(11 + 7i) = 170 = 2 ⋅ 5 ⋅ 17 N(18 − i) = 325 = 52 ⋅ 13 hence d = gcd (11 + 7i, 18 − i) is either an element of norm 5 or a unit, because it can be proved that N(u) = 1 iff u is invertible. WebTo find the GCF of two numbers list the factors of each number. Then mark the common factors in both lists. The greatest marked factor is the GCF. What GCF is used for? GCF (greatest common factor) is the largest positive integer that divides evenly into two or more given numbers. It is commonly used to simplify fractions.
